+# Format Plugin for SPSS (SAV) Files
+This format plugin enables Apache Drill to read and query Statistical Package for the Social Sciences (SPSS) (or Statistical Product and Service Solutions) data files. According
+ to Wikipedia: [1]
+ 
+ SPSS is a widely used program for statistical analysis in social science. It is also used by market researchers, health researchers, survey companies, government, education researchers, marketing organizations, data miners, and others. The original SPSS manual (Nie, Bent & Hull, 1970) has been described as one of "sociology's most influential books" for allowing ordinary researchers to do their own statistical analysis. In addition to statistical analysis, data management (case selection, file reshaping, creating derived data) and data documentation (a metadata dictionary is stored in the datafile) are features of the base software.

+## Configuration 
+To configure Drill to read SPSS files, simply add the following code to the formats section of your file-based storage plugin.  This should happen automatically for the default
+ `cp`, `dfs`, and `S3` storage plugins.
+ 
+ Other than the file extensions, there are no variables to configure.
